Is JS safe or scam
JS, officially known as JS Forex Broker, has been in operation for about 2 to 5 years. The company claims to be headquartered in London, United Kingdom, although specific details about its office location are vague, merely stating 40 Bank Street without further specifics. JS operates as a private company, providing services primarily to retail clients interested in forex trading.
The broker's development has been marked by certain milestones, including its establishment and the launch of its trading platform. However, it has faced significant scrutiny due to its unregulated status and allegations of operating as a clone firm. JS broker primarily offers retail forex services, catering to both novice and experienced traders looking to engage in a variety of financial markets.
The business model of JS broker focuses on facilitating forex trading, although it also claims to provide access to other financial instruments. This includes a range of trading accounts designed to accommodate different levels of traders, from beginners to more advanced investors.
JS broker is currently unregulated, which poses significant risks for potential investors. The broker has not provided any valid regulatory information, and there are no records indicating its registration with major financial authorities such as the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A). The lack of transparency regarding its licensing raises concerns about the legitimacy of its operations.
JS broker does not disclose any regulatory numbers or specific licenses, which is a critical aspect for investors seeking to verify the broker's compliance with financial regulations. The absence of a valid regulatory framework means that customer funds are not protected under any investor compensation schemes. Furthermore, the broker does not appear to have a clear policy regarding the segregation of client funds, which is a standard practice among regulated brokers.
In terms of compliance, JS broker claims to adhere to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) measures; however, the effectiveness of these policies remains questionable given the broker's overall lack of regulation and transparency.

JS broker claims to support MetaTrader 4 (MT4), which is a popular trading platform among forex traders. However, there is no mention of MetaTrader 5 (MT5) support. The broker may also offer a proprietary trading platform, although specific details about its functionalities are not provided.
In terms of accessibility, JS broker offers a web-based trading platform along with mobile applications for both iOS and Android devices, allowing traders to manage their accounts on the go. The execution model is not explicitly stated, but there are indications that the broker may utilize Market Making practices.
The technical infrastructure details, including server locations and API access for automated trading, are not disclosed, which raises questions about the broker's operational capabilities and reliability.
JS broker provides several account types, starting with a standard account that requires a minimum deposit of €250. The exact spread and commission structure is not detailed, but there are indications that the broker may offer competitive pricing.
For more advanced traders, higher-level accounts such as VIP or professional accounts may be available, providing additional features and benefits. However, the specifics of these accounts, including minimum deposits and associated perks, are not clearly outlined.
The broker also claims to offer Islamic accounts, catering to clients who require Sharia-compliant trading conditions. The availability of a demo account is mentioned, allowing potential clients to test the platform before committing real funds.
Leverage ratios are not explicitly stated, but it is common for brokers to offer leverage ranging from 1:100 to 1:500 depending on the asset class. The minimum trading lot size and overnight fees are not detailed, which could impact trading strategies for potential clients.
JS broker supports a variety of deposit methods, including traditional options such as bank transfers, credit cards, and electronic wallets. The minimum deposit requirements vary by account type, with the standard account starting at €250.
Deposit processing times are typically immediate, although specific timeframes are not mentioned. There are no indications of deposit fees, which is a positive aspect for potential clients.
For withdrawals, JS broker offers multiple methods, but the specifics regarding withdrawal limits and processing times are not clearly defined. There are indications that withdrawal requests may take between 1 to 5 business days to process, but this can vary based on the method chosen. The fee structure for withdrawals is also not disclosed, raising concerns about potential hidden costs associated with fund management.
